Instructions
Preheat oven to 325F (163C).
Mix almond butter, water, and salt until combined.
Add pea protein, and combine into a dough. You may need to use your hands.
Fold in chocolate chips.
Break into 8 pieces, and roll each into a ball. Press and flatten each onto a parchment-lined cookie sheet.
Bake for about 12 minutes, or until firm.
Let cool, and enjoy!
Notes
This recipe works with pea protein, rice protein, or blends of these. The recipe would turn out very differently with other types of protein.
